QUOTE(tailtwist @ Mar 13 2012, 10:20 AM)
» Click to show Spoiler - click again to hide... «


From UOB singapore's website
You must be a Singapore Citizen or Singapore Permanent Resident and at least 21 years old.
A minimum annual income of S$30,000.
Foreigners require a minimum annual income of S$36,000, or if you do not meet the income requirements, a Fixed Deposit collateral of minimum S$10,000 is required
Supplementary card applicants must be aged 18 years and above.

Sourcesource

So i think it still varies from bank to bank and probably the credit card type as well
*
So UOB have the least stringent requirement, but still SGD$3k per month shocking.gif
